Abbey Wood Train Station boasts a range of amenities to improve your travel experience. The ticket office is open from 06:10 to 20:05 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 07:30 to 19:30 on Sundays, offering flexible hours to cater to your scheduling needs. Ticket machines are available for quick and convenient ticket purchases and collections.
For those requiring assistance, the station provides fully accessible ticket machines and an induction loop. Step-free access throughout ensures that passengers with mobility needs can navigate the station with ease. Staff assistance is readily available, and there's an abundance of seating areas on platforms and in the ticket hall for your comfort.
Family-friendly facilities include baby changing amenities and accessible toilets. For those in need of refreshment, coffee and confectionary options are available on-site. While there are no shops or ATMs, the station is equipped with CCTV for the safety and security of its passengers.
Abbey Wood Train Station is well-connected through various modes of transportation. For local travel, Transport for London buses operate from just outside the station. If you're heading towards Dartford or Plumstead, rail replacement services can whisk you to your destination efficiently.
For international travelers or those with flight connections, the Elizabeth Line offers direct services to Heathrow Terminals 2 and 3, with further connections to Terminals 4 and 5. Abbey Wood's strategic position makes it an ideal starting point for both domestic journeys and global adventures.

London Euston is designed to accommodate a high volume of passengers efficiently. The ticket office is open from 6:00 AM to 10:30 PM during weekdays, with slightly varied times at weekends, ensuring you can get your tickets easily. There are numerous ticket machines throughout the station, including accessible options, and assistance is always at hand should you require help.
Passengers can avail themselves of a range of facilities such as public toilets, including accessible ones, and baby changing rooms. For those who wish to freshen up, showers are available, particularly in the First Class Lounge, shared between the Caledonian Sleeper and Avanti West Coast. If you're feeling peckish or require some last-minute shopping, a variety of food outlets and shops are situated within the station. Public Wi-Fi and payphones ensure you're always connected.
Euston Station is committed to being as accessible as possible. The station offers step-free access throughout, making it suitable for wheelchair users or those with mobility impairments. Lifts connect the concourse with taxi and car park areas, as well as the Underground ticket hall, though the Underground itself only provides escalators and stairs.
For passengers requiring mobility assistance, the station provides dedicated services. You can arrange for assistance by contacting the Mobility Assistance Lounge Reception, which is located conveniently near the main entrance.
The station is well-connected to a host of onward travel options making it an ideal departure point. The taxi rank is conveniently located at the front of the bus station adjacent to Eversholt Street. Bus services are easily accessible, with step-free access ensuring everyone can travel without hindrance. For those using the Underground, Euston offers links to the Northern and Victoria Lines, while nearby stations expand your choices. If rail services are disrupted, rail replacement services are available at Platform 2.
